Getting the Right Motorcycle Coverage to Fit Your Budget
by J Biri
Just like with automobile insurance, every state requires anyone who rides a motorcycle to have at a bare minimum liability insurance to cover medical costs and property damage of another party if the motorcyclist if
found at fault in the accident. Additionally, if the motorcycle is financed, the finance company will likely require the motorcyclist to carry comprehensive and collision coverage as well. While there are similarities between purchasing automobile and motorcycle insurance coverage, knowing the differences can save money while making sure you have adequate coverage for your needs
